Been a busy year so far, if you've been by you've probably seen our orchards are getting cleaned up! We just got a new batch of plum and cherry trees planted. Started a new asparagus bed too.

Cabbage, broccoli and peas are in the ground. All the tomatoes, peppers and eggplant are growing nicely.

The basil and a few of the flowers got hit on the frosty night, but they are restarted so will have a little delay there. The first of the asparagus also got hit with the frost, new shoots are on the way so hopefully by next weekend they'll be on the stand.
